Role Description Stefanini is looking for a Network Engineer-Remote. Responsibilities: - Design and Implementation - Architecture Design: Design F5 LTM and GTM solutions that align with business requirements and best practices. - Configuration: - Configure and manage F5 BIG-IP LTM and GTM modules. - Implement high-availability and disaster recovery solutions. - Automation: - Develop and maintain scripts and automation workflows for F5 configurations. - Integrate F5 solutions with CI/CD pipelines. - Operations and Maintenance - Monitoring: - Monitor F5 device performance and health using various monitoring tools. - Set up alerts and notifications for critical issues. - Troubleshooting: - Diagnose and resolve complex issues related to F5 LTM and GTM. - Perform root cause analysis and implement solutions to prevent recurrence. - Upgrades and Patching: - Plan and execute F5 software upgrades and patches. - Ensure minimal downtime during maintenance activities. - Security Configurations: - Implement and maintain security configurations on F5 devices. - Ensure compliance with organizational security policies and standards. - Technical Documentation: - Create and maintain detailed documentation for F5 configurations, procedures, and best practices. - Document incident responses and resolutions. - Collaboration: - Work closely with application teams, network engineers, and other stakeholders to ensure seamless integration of F5 solutions. Qualifications - Educational Background: -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Engineering, or a related field. - Certifications: - F5 Certified Technician: BIG-IP (101 or 201) - F5 Certified Implementation Specialist: Local Traffic Manager (201 or 301) - F5 Certified Implementation Specialist: Global Traffic Manager (201 or 301) - F5 Certified Solutions Expert: Application Delivery Fundamentals (301 or 401) - Experience: - Minimum of 5-7 years of experience with F5 products, specifically LTM and GTM. - Configuration and management of F5 BIG-IP LTM and GTM modules. - Experience with high-availability (HA) configurations. - Scripting and automation experience. - Technical Skills: - Networking: Strong understanding of TCP/IP, DNS, HTTP/HTTPS, and other relevant protocols. - Experience with load balancing algorithms and persistence methods. - Security: Knowledge of SSL/TLS, security protocols, and best practices. - Experience with F5 security features like ASM (Application Security Manager) is a plus. - Cloud Experience (nice to have): Experience with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and integrating F5 with cloud services. - Monitoring and Logging: Experience with monitoring tools like Nagios, Zabbix, or Prometheus. - Familiarity with log management solutions like Splunk. - Soft Skills: - Problem-Solving: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. - Communication: Excellent verbal and written communication skills. - Ability to explain compl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ders. - Teamwork: Ability to work effectively in a team environment.
